摘要
The Czech agrarian foreign trade recorded significant changes during the last years. Its value, volume and territorial and commodity structure and performance are changing fast. This paper aims to identify changes which have occurred during the analysed time period. Except for individual changes also individual factors responsible for them are specified. The paper provides the following findings related to Czech agrarian trade performance. While the territorial structure became even more concentrated, the commodity structure became more diversified. The Czech trade is quite competitive especially in relation to the European countries, while the competitiveness in relation to other territories is limited. The significant weakness of the Czech agrarian trade is its inability to generate added value. The Czech agrarian trade comparative advantages are existing especially in relation to the following set of aggregations: Cereals, Live animals, Oil seeds, Tobacco products, Dairy products, Sugar, Vegetable oils, saps and plaiting materials, Milling products, Beverages and alcohol. In relation to the rest of the World (without EU28 internal trade) Czech agrarian trade is competitive especially in relation to the following commodity groups Live animals, Dairy products, Sugar, Beverages and alcohol, Oil seeds, Preparation of cereals, Milling products, Cocoa preparations, Vegetable saps and Tobacco products.
